Hervé Griffon, Sébastien Mazard, Jean Navarro, Florent Roubertie
Mutation Urbaine
École d'Architecture de Paris Val de Marne
France 2000, 9’

Urban change is a reality developing under our eyes: since the city can no longer fulfill its needs, it has to evolve. This work is a project of renovation of the old Renault factories in Boulogne-Billancourt. It is an alternative to the various projects which have been already presented and, at in the meantime, it is an answer to the interpellation made by the trade union of Val de Seine which requested an area of one million square meters where to build.

Hervé Griffon was born in 1974 and obtained his D.P.L.G. diploma in 2000. In 1997 and 1998, he was a finalist of the “Grand Prix d’Architecture” (the French academy).

Sébastien Mazard was born in 1974 and obtained his D.P.L.G. diploma in 2000. In 1996 and 1997, he studied architecture at the University of Architecture in Luton, near London.

Jean Navarro was born in 1971 and obtained his D.P.L.G. diploma in 2000. In 1996 and 1997, he studied at the University of Architecture of Madrid.

Florent Roubertie was born in 1974. He has obtained a D.P.L.G. diploma. In 1996 and 1997, he studied at the University of Architecture in Luton, near London. In 1996, he was awarded the second price of the “Grand Prix d’Architecture” (the French academy).

We have been friends for 10 years and we share the same passion. Each of us has studied in the same Studio in Paris. We have been twice (in July 1998 and July 1999) to Pietra Monte Corvino, in Italy, in order to work for an International Laboratory of architectural and urban projects. Currently, we are all working in different agencies in Paris. We are taking part in competitions and/or rehabilitation projects. During holidays, we love travelling in different places all around Europe to discover famous architects, such as Nouvel, Koolhass, MVRDV, Herzog and de Meuron, Piano, Siza, Souto de Moura…We have been working together for our diploma. Our subject was a research on the urban mutation. The video we present is the fruit of 18 months of work.
